Ballet dancer Dawid Trzensimiech from Royal Opera House Covent Garden joins the National Opera Ballet in Bucharest in March and he can be seen for the first time today at 7 pm in the contemporary dance show “Tango. Radio and Juliet.” Dawid Trzensimiech was born in Poland and studied with the National Ballet School in Bytom. Among his roles he performed there are the Prince in the “Nutcracker” by Pyotr Ilyich Tchaikovsky, James in “La Sylphide” by Herman Severin Lovenskiold, Lenski in “Onegin” by Kurt-Heinz Stolze, Benvolio in “Romeo and Juliet” by Sergei Prokofiev, Florestan in “Sleeping Beauty” by Pyotr Ilyich Tchaikovsky.
